In Rogers, Arkansas, every property owner is expected to exercise reasonable care when it comes to maintaining their property. It is their responsibility to mitigate accidents from happening on their premises. If the property owner fails to maintain a safe property which results in someone dying or getting injured on their property, they will be held liable.

This applies to every person that enters the property of the owner, except for trespassers. If you are a trespasser and you happen to get injured while on someone’s property, then the owner might not be held liable, depending on the circumstances. We need to understand that you have to show that the property owner was negligent in the maintenance of the property, for you to win a premises liability claim.
